WebOct 10, 2024 · Deliver it then with all sincerity in your heart. Then, from your heart, support it with your facial expressions, hand gestures, and body movements that highlight and enhance the various performance aspects of your poem. Use clear enunciation. This means that, what your are saying can be understood by the audience. WebJun 7, 2024 · Poets choose words for their meaning and acoustics, arranging them to create a tempo known as the meter. Some poems incorporate rhyme schemes, with two or more lines that end in like-sounding words. Today, poetry remains an … WebPoetry’s purpose is essential to help us understand the world around us.
